Poem: Child Of Caera

A Child's Fate

From the depths of the sea

Was a child, filled with curiosity

Dreaming about the world above, he always wondered

When he would see the girl of light

 

He sought the light with an outstretched hand

As he reached of age

He wished to achieve his dream

To see her world with his own eyes

 

Join in his dream, in his song of hope and love

Where the sun, illuminated the sky

Pray that the light may sway, sway towards his way

For the child's own fate

 

From the depths of the sea

Was a child, now at the surface of the light

Regardless of the price, he sacrificed 

The gift of voice

 

She, who was nearly devoured by the sea

Unbeknownst to her

She brought her savior in, to where she lived

Gave his name, where they lived side by side

 

Join in their tale, in her time, of friendship and trust

Where the sun shone upon the sea

Vow to take the light, to stay by her side

For the child's own fate

 

May his chosen path lead him with kindness

Yet, he knows two fates await him, be it joy or regret

Near the end, he will find his courage, yet meet his weakness

For the light in his heart had fallen for another

 

Under the moonlight

With the gleaming knife

He stares upon his beloved

With the words of his brothers in mind

He raised it up high, only to hesitate at the sight

 

Intertwined with another, she peacefully sleeps

A gentle smile adorning her face

With his resolve, he threw the shard back to the sea

Looking towards the starry sky with content 

 

At the first ribbon of sunrise

He looks upon the ocean from whence he came 

With a last glance at his reflection

He closes his eyes

To welcome the abyss that awaits him

 

From the depths of the sea

Was a child no longer in sight

His beloved cried

With a goodbye

He flew to the sky
